diff options
author | Boutade <thegoofist@protonmail.com> | 2019-09-25 12:04:25 -0500 |
---|---|---|
committer | Boutade <thegoofist@protonmail.com> | 2019-09-25 12:04:25 -0500 |
commit | 4e5ee14582cf2f918a76ffb9e37ee9c5809a53b2 (patch) | |
tree | 89de36b6d5f9740f9286ff68b54eac54312fcfb5 /granolin.lisp | |
parent | 293d967eeda090f62cdefa8f98849642b8715162 (diff) |
bugfix
Diffstat (limited to 'granolin.lisp')
-rw-r--r-- | granolin.lisp | 7 |
1 files changed, 4 insertions, 3 deletions
diff --git a/granolin.lisp b/granolin.lisp index 68534cb..ed25128 100644 --- a/granolin.lisp +++ b/granolin.lisp @@ -119,6 +119,7 @@ (def-json-wrap room-state-event (event-content :|content|) + (sender :|sender|) (event-type :|type|) (event-id :|event_id|) (state-key :|state_key|) @@ -267,18 +268,18 @@ ;; handle the timeline events (aka room events) (dolist (ob (getob room :|timeline| :|events|)) (setf (timeline-event-data message-event) ob) - (handle-timeline-event client room-id message-event)) + (handle-event client room-id message-event)) ;; handle state chnage events (aka state events) (dolist (ob (getob room :|state| :|events|)) (setf (room-state-event-data state-event) ob) - (handle-room-state-event client room-id state-event))))) + (handle-event client room-id state-event))))) (defun process-invited-room-events (client) (let ((invite-event (make-invitation-event :data nil))) (loop :for (room-id room . ignore) :on (invited-rooms *response-object*) :by #'cddr :do (dolist (ob (getob room :|invite_state| :|events|)) (setf (invitation-event-data invite-event) ob) - (handle-invitation-event client room-id invite-event))))) + (handle-event client room-id invite-event))))) ;;; bot loop |